Silbeth - Girl Name Meaning and Pronunciation

Silbeth

Silbeth is a unique and enchanting name that conveys a sense of elegance and beauty. Although its exact meaning remains ambiguous, it often evokes associations with brightness and warmth, possibly derived from the roots relating to 'silver' or 'silvery,' suggesting qualities like brilliance and purity. The name is used in rare instances, mostly among those who appreciate unconventional names.

The name Silbeth is primarily perceived as feminine, making it a graceful choice for girls. The fluidity and melodic tone resonate with parents seeking a distinct name for their daughter.

Silbeth may not have historical significance in major cultural narratives, but its rarity gives it an exclusive aura, making it appealing to many modern parents. While Silbeth might not frequently appear in popular culture, its poetic sound and ethereal qualities leave a lasting impression.
